    Problem connecting to the internet using Windows XP Mode...


    I'm using windows 7 64 bit Pro and I recently installed the Acrylic DNS Server Proxy program in order to maintain connectivity with my Mede8er media player when it is on the network. This required me to change the setting on the IP version 4 tab on my Win 7 network adapter from "obtaining the DNS server address automatically" to using 127.0.0.1.

    I can connect to the internet with no trouble on the Win 7 side but now when I launch Windows XP Mode in the Windows Virtual PC none of my browsers there will connect to the internet. My Dreamweaver program still accesses the internet on that side but nothing else will.

    What settings do I need to change on the Virtual PC side so that I have connectivity again? Should I install Acrylic on that side as well?

    Any suggestions?

    Well fortunately, I was able to figure it out. All I needed to do was install Acrylic on the Virtual XP machine. Works fine now.
